Output e57e00530d373d76b3e4c6f05fdbf63660bcc6cbcb76b7304eed85ce824d255d:0

value
16050581
script pubkey
OP_0 OP_PUSHBYTES_20 2d30040e2c4b9884fc7e11ea1e05b84f48566ec4
address
bc1q95cqgr3vfwvgflr7z84pupdcfay9vmky5l5ue6
transaction
e57e00530d373d76b3e4c6f05fdbf63660bcc6cbcb76b7304eed85ce824d255d
spent
true